The Children’s Ombudsman is a government agency tasked with representing the rights and interests of children and young people based on the UN Convention on the Rights of the Child. The agency must particularly ensure that laws and regulations comply with the Convention and promote its implementation in society. The mandate also includes informing and raising awareness about issues concerning the rights of children and young people.

The Children’s Ombudsman is now seeking a digital communicator for a permanent full-time position.

Responsibilities

As a communicator at the Children’s Ombudsman, you will be responsible for communication in close collaboration with the agency's employees. In addition to regular communicator tasks, you will have a special responsibility for web communication.

  • Contribute to the agency's communication in digital channels.
  • Ongoing work with the website's content, structure, and development.
  • Write and tailor texts for different channels and contexts.
  • Provide communication support related to project work, report releases, broadcasts, and external activities.
  • Perform administrative work and internal communication.

The work is carried out independently and in collaboration with colleagues within the agency.

Qualifications

  • Higher education in communication or other education and experience deemed equivalent by the employer.
  • Several years of experience working as a communicator.
  • Documented and current experience in web publishing using Optimizely and Umbraco, or equivalent.
  • Experience in developing web structure, usability, and digital accessibility.
  • Good ability to express yourself in speech and writing in Swedish.
  • Ability to tailor messages for digital channels.
  • Experience in communication aimed at children and young people.
  • Experience in planning, implementing, and following up on communication projects.

Desirable

  • Knowledge of the Accessibility Act for Digital Public Services.
  • Experience in tracking and analyzing statistics for web or social media.
  • Experience in search engine optimization (SEO).
  • Experience working within a government agency or other public sector.
  • Experience in producing and publishing digital communication materials (text, image, video, and audio).
  • Knowledge of children's rights and the Convention on the Rights of the Child.

Personal Qualities

The work requires independence, good collaboration skills, and a sense of responsibility. You are structured, meticulous, and able to prioritize tasks. You combine a user perspective with an understanding of the agency's mission and requirements for quality and accuracy. Great emphasis will be placed on personal suitability.
